Output 51ad302e3656150ff8b7f8d83b9869c9b042de755ed10b3b4bc8e8dce28a015a:0

value
5777937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72359a8b6f5cc548b6e650bc5bc56e05ffd824f OP_EQUAL
address
3KqxjtsLi91FKEvWmWpwC6TjWLHELiuLgc
transaction
51ad302e3656150ff8b7f8d83b9869c9b042de755ed10b3b4bc8e8dce28a015a
spent
true